authentik logo

authentik

Take control of your identity needs with a secure, flexible, and open-source identity provider.

Quick Info

Starting at Free
0 reviews
Grow stage

Overview

authentik is an open-source identity provider designed to give organizations complete control over their authentication and authorization needs. It serves as a robust alternative to commercial solutions like Azure/Entra ID, Ping, Keycloak, and Okta, emphasizing security through transparency and community review. By allowing self-hosting, authentik ensures that sensitive identity data remains within the organization's infrastructure, reducing reliance on third-party services. The platform is built for flexibility and scalability, offering pre-built workflows alongside extensive customization options through configurable templates, infrastructure as code, and comprehensive APIs. This allows users to tailor every step of the authentication process to their specific requirements. With support for both B2B and B2C use cases, authentik aims to provide a unified and cost-effective solution for managing identities across a wide array of applications and services, from cloud providers to internal tools.

Pricing

Open Source

Free

  • Supports OIDC, SAML, LDAP, SCIM, RADIUS, Kerberos, and Proxy
  • Web-based RDP/SSH access
  • Covers B2B and B2C use cases
  • Community Discord
  • No support
POPULAR

Professional

$5 / user

  • Everything in Open Source
  • Enhanced audit logging for compliance
  • Google Workspace integration
  • Microsoft Entra ID integration
  • Embed external OAuth/SAML sources
  • Chrome Enterprise Device Trust connector
  • Shared Signals Framework (ABM) support
  • Password history compliance checks
  • Client certificate authentication (mTLS)
  • Ticket-based support for subscriptions over $1k

Pros & Cons

Pros

  • Open-source nature provides transparency and community-driven security reviews.
  • High flexibility and customizability through workflows, templates, and APIs.
  • Self-hosted solution eliminates reliance on third-party services for critical infrastructure.
  • Streamlined pricing model covers core functionality without hidden costs.
  • Supports a wide range of applications and integrations out-of-the-box.
  • Scalable to handle both B2B and B2C identity needs.
  • Strong focus on security from design to implementation.

Cons

  • Requires technical expertise for deployment, configuration, and maintenance.
  • Self-hosting means users are responsible for infrastructure and security updates.
  • Learning curve might be steeper compared to fully managed, simpler IDP solutions.
  • Community support might be less immediate than enterprise-level paid support from commercial vendors.

Use Cases

Reviews & Ratings

0.0

0 reviews

5
0% (0)
4
0% (0)
3
0% (0)
2
0% (0)
1
0% (0)

Share Your Experience

Sign in to write a review and help other indie hackers make informed decisions.

Sign In to Write a Review

No Reviews Yet

Be the first to share your experience with this tool!

Best For

  • Centralizing identity management for internal company applications.
  • Providing secure authentication for customer-facing applications (B2C).
  • Replacing proprietary or expensive identity providers with an open-source alternative.
  • Implementing Single Sign-On (SSO) across a diverse application ecosystem.
  • Organizations requiring high levels of control and customization over their identity infrastructure.

Ready to try authentik?

Join thousands of indie hackers building with authentik